NYC Housing Lottery Alerts is an independent email notification service operated by 123 CR SERVICES LLC, designed for individuals applying for New York City affordable housing lotteries. It monitors public data related to NYC Housing Connect and sends alerts when new lottery opportunities match a user’s borough, bedroom count, and income/AMI requirements. The website clearly states that it is not an official service of the New York City government, HPD, HDC, or Housing Connect.
The product centers on “monitoring—matching—alerts”: the system checks housing lottery information across the five boroughs based on NYC Open Data/HPD datasets, tracking newly opened projects, deadlines, bedroom counts, rents, income requirements, and application links. Users can set preferences by Borough, Bedroom, and income range/AMI. Basic includes real-time email alerts, deadline reminders, and weekly summaries; Pro adds match scoring, personalized document checklists, income and AMI eligibility verification, document upload and accuracy review, application readiness scoring, and 24-hour priority support.
Pricing is simple and transparent: Basic costs $2.99/month, while Pro costs $6.99/month. Both are billed monthly, can be canceled at any time, and have no hidden fees. Payments are processed through Stripe. The terms mention that users may request a prorated refund within 7 days of an initial subscription or renewal if they have not received any alerts. No free plan or free trial information was found.
The strengths are its precise positioning and low barrier to entry, addressing the pain point of repeatedly checking Housing Connect manually. Its data comes from NYC Open Data, offering fairly good transparency. The pricing is low, making it suitable for long-term individual subscriptions. The drawbacks are also clear: the service only provides alerts, cannot apply on users’ behalf, and does not affect lottery outcomes. Email delivery, data completeness, and timeliness are not absolutely guaranteed. Notification channels are relatively limited, with no visible mobile app, SMS, API, team permissions, or enterprise-grade compliance capabilities.
It is suitable for individual renters looking for rent-stabilized/affordable housing in New York who do not want to manually check Housing Connect every day. Pro is better suited for users who are uncertain about preparing application documents or determining income eligibility.
